The surname 'Braggio' is believed to have originated from Italy, specifically from the region of Lombardy. It is thought to be derived from the Latin word 'bragium', which means a fine or luxurious cloth. This suggests that the original bearers of the surname 'Braggio' may have been associated with the textile or clothing industry.
In Italy, the surname 'Braggio' is most commonly found in the Lombardy region, especially in the provinces of Bergamo and Brescia. It has been passed down through generations, and many families in these areas still bear this surname with pride. The incidence of the surname 'Braggio' in Italy is 683, making it a moderately common surname in the country.
Interestingly, the surname 'Braggio' is also found in Brazil, with an incidence of 467. It is believed that Italian immigrants brought the surname to Brazil, where it has become established in certain communities.
